About This Item

London: Hamish Hamilton, 2019. First edition, first printing. Published by Hamish Hamilton in London, 2019. This is a fine copy. The lime-green dust wrapper is bright and attractive with the bold title. It has not been price clipped and is with the 'Signed Copy' sticker on the front panel. The boards are tight and free from wear. The text blocks are bright and white. The authors signature is present on the limitation page, flatsigned in red ink. Overall, this is a fine copy of a nice title. A dazzling collection of short fiction.
